It looks like that you call your function outside of an Embperl Request. Udat is only available, from inside an Embperl page, not before or after
Gerald
Von: Benni Bärmann [mailto:bennibaermann@gmail.com]
Gesendet: Mittwoch, 17. Mai 2017 07:56
An: embperl@perl.apache.org
Betreff: Fwd: undefined value in Emperl/Util.pm
Hello everybody,
i try to give some new life to an old emperl aplication, but there is this error (shown in the browser):
Error in Perl code: Can't call method "app" on an undefined value at /usr/lib/x86_64-linux-gnu/perl5/5.22/Embperl/Util.pm line 108.
My environment ist the standard packages for Apache2, mod_perl and Embperl for Ubuntu 16.04
Versions:
Apache2: 2.4.18-2ubuntu3.2
Perl v5.22.1
mod_perl 2.0.9-4ubuntu1
Embperl 2.5.0
any hints about this?
Thanks, Benni
Gerald
Von: Benni Bärmann [mailto:bennibaermann@gmail.com]
Gesendet: Mittwoch, 17. Mai 2017 07:56
An: embperl@perl.apache.org
Betreff: Fwd: undefined value in Emperl/Util.pm
Hello everybody,
i try to give some new life to an old emperl aplication, but there is this error (shown in the browser):
Error in Perl code: Can't call method "app" on an undefined value at /usr/lib/x86_64-linux-gnu/perl5/5.22/Embperl/Util.pm line 108.
My environment ist the standard packages for Apache2, mod_perl and Embperl for Ubuntu 16.04
Versions:
Apache2: 2.4.18-2ubuntu3.2
Perl v5.22.1
mod_perl 2.0.9-4ubuntu1
Embperl 2.5.0
any hints about this?
Thanks, Benni